Output 23f38b84aebfe5859528a9d129bfe312e525d0738eed9df25d339abffa063021:5

value
1541
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69576b3bd948501798e39021998cccab52dc57a3f3d13b07a7ea5732f891ff7b
address
bc1pd9tkkw7efpgp0x8rjqsenrxv4dfdc4ar70gnkpa8aftn97y3laasdxkfln
transaction
23f38b84aebfe5859528a9d129bfe312e525d0738eed9df25d339abffa063021
spent
true